Analysis
Senegal recorded 39 m3 for unspecified area — fibreboard — import quantity in 2012.
The figure is up 95.0% on the previous year and down 74.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, unspecified area — fibreboard — import quantity in Senegal peaked at 152 m3 in 2000 and was at its lowest, 14 m3, in 2008.
That places Senegal 27th out of 68 countries with data for 2012, putting it in the middle of the range.
